Factors to Consider When Choosing Av Over Ip Transmitters for Digital Signage

When selecting AV over IP transmitters for digital signage, I consider factors like device compatibility, transmission range, and video quality to guarantee seamless performance. Ease of installation and the network infrastructure needed also influence my choice, especially for larger setups. Understanding these points helps me choose the right transmitter that meets both technical and operational needs.
Compatibility With Devices
Choosing the right AV over IP transmitter hinges on ensuring it’s compatible with your existing devices and infrastructure. First, check that it supports the same video resolutions and formats as your displays to avoid compatibility issues. It’s also essential to verify compatibility with your network infrastructure, such as supporting Power over Ethernet (PoE) if your system relies on it. Ensuring support for HDCP 2.2 is vital for secure transmission of protected digital content. Additionally, confirm the transmitter can connect seamlessly with your control systems—IR, RS-232, or TCP/IP—for integrated management. Finally, make sure it supports the input and output interfaces of your source and display devices, like HDMI or HDBaseT, to guarantee proper connectivity and smooth operation across your digital signage setup.

Video Quality Requirements
Ensuring the best video quality in digital signage requires selecting AV over IP transmitters that support the right specifications. First, check if the device handles high resolutions like 4K or 1080p to meet modern display standards. HDCP 2.2 compliance is essential for protecting high-bandwidth digital content during transmission. Low latency, ideally below 30 milliseconds, guarantees smooth, real-time playback without lag. Advanced color formats, such as 4:4:4 chroma subsampling, deliver vibrant, true-to-life visuals, which are critical for impactful signage. Additionally, verify the maximum supported bandwidth and compression standards like H.265 or H.264 to guarantee high-quality video over the network. These factors collectively assure crisp, seamless, and visually appealing digital signage experiences.

Network Infrastructure Needs
Choosing the right AV over IP transmitters isn’t just about the devices themselves; it depends heavily on the network infrastructure supporting them. A robust network with Gigabit Ethernet switches is essential, especially for high-resolution signals like 4K. You need enough bandwidth and minimal congestion to ensure smooth, high-quality video without lag or buffering. Supporting Power over Ethernet (PoE) simplifies installation by combining power and data in a single cable. Proper network topology, including segmentation and VLANs, helps prioritize AV traffic and reduces interference from other data streams. Compatibility with existing hardware and scalability for future expansion are also key. A well-designed network infrastructure guarantees reliable, high-performance digital signage deployments that can grow with your needs.

What Security Features Are AVailable in Modern AV Over IP Transmitters?
Think of security as the backbone of modern AV over IP transmitters. They often feature robust encryption protocols like AES, secure network authentication, and VLAN segmentation, which act like digital vaults protecting your content. Many also support firmware updates to patch vulnerabilities. I’ve found these features essential, as they guarantee your digital signage remains private and tamper-proof, giving you peace of mind in an increasingly connected world.
